my son (plural my sons)

  1. Refers to the person one is addressing, when giving caution or advice, indicating that the person is inferior in some way. It does not necessarily refer to a relationship.
    • 1999, John Buchan, Greenmantle, page 123:
      Now, look here, my son, I said; you're a kid and a know nothing.
